Crafted in Denmark during the 1960s, this elegant bookcase features a beautifully grained rosewood veneer structure resting on a classic wooden plinth. Inside, it offers four practical shelves—two of which are height-adjustable—providing flexible storage for books or collector’s items. Its slim profile and refined design make it ideal for maximizing storage in compact living spaces while maintaining a stylish mid-century aesthetic. The surface has been professionally refreshed, with minor scratches, marks, and some veneer losses visible, consistent with its vintage character. Shelves can be removed for safe transport. Assembly is straightforward—video instructions available upon request. The bookcase is fully functional and ready to enhance your interior.
